A Collier County man was arrested in connection with an assault that occurred in the River Park East community.

According to the Collier County Sheriff’s Office, Andrew Bolden, a 21-year-old man of unincorporated Collier County, was taken into custody on Thursday on charges of occupied burglary with assault or battery.

The incident took place when Bolden, who is an acquaintance of the victim, drove to the victim’s residence, entered a vehicle parked in the driveway, and began physically attacking the victim.

Authorities said Bolden then pulled the victim from the vehicle and continued the assault in the front yard before fleeing upon learning police had been called.

Naples Police Department officers investigated the scene, and Collier County Sheriff’s deputies later arrested Bolden at his home.

He was transported to the Naples Jail Center.

No further details were immediately available.
